Writing a letter to a magical character is one of the most exciting activities for children. Whether it's Santa Claus, the Tooth Fairy, or the Easter Bunny, these letters help children express their dreams, wishes, and imagination.
Start with a Warm Greeting
Encourage your child to begin their letter with a friendly hello. "Dear Santa" or "Hello Tooth Fairy" sets a warm tone for the rest of the letter. Let them add their own special touch!
Share Something Special
Before jumping to wishes, it's wonderful when children share something about themselves. Maybe they learned to ride a bike, helped a friend, or started a new hobby. This personal touch makes letters extra special.
Express Wishes Clearly
Help your child think about what they truly wish for. It doesn't always have to be toys - wishes for family happiness, a pet, or even world peace show depth and kindness.
Add Drawings and Decorations
Nothing makes a letter more magical than colorful drawings, stickers, or glitter. Encourage creativity! A hand-drawn picture speaks a thousand words.
Don't Forget to Say Thank You
Teaching gratitude is important. Remind your child to thank the magical character for all the joy they bring throughout the year.
Most importantly, have fun with the process. These letters become treasured memories that families cherish for years to come.
